Wasaga Beach business owners may need a corporate reorganization when a company is preparing for succession, financing, family ownership changes, asset planning, or a future sale. A corporation may need a holding company, estate freeze, share exchange, rollover documents, amended share classes, or updated records so the structure better matches the business plan.

Goldstone Law PC helps Wasaga Beach clients prepare restructuring documents and update corporate records. We review the articles, minute book, share registers, shareholder agreements, financing documents, accountant notes, family trust materials, and proposed ownership chart. That review helps identify approvals, restrictions, lender consent issues, missing records, filings, and the proper order for implementation.

The legal work may include holding company documents, share exchange agreements, rollover materials, estate freeze records, amended articles, resolutions, updated registers, certificates, consents, and closing books. If the restructuring is connected to accountant advice or family succession, the documents should clearly show what changed and how the structure works.

Should my accountant be involved?

Yes. Tax planning should usually be reviewed with an accountant before legal documents are prepared.

Can restructuring help with family succession?

It can. Corporate restructuring may support estate freeze planning, family ownership transition, succession planning, or future sale preparation.

Can shareholder or lender consent be required?

Yes. Financing documents, shareholder agreements, investor rights, or articles may require consent before ownership changes.
